toarray方法
toArray方法是一种基于JavaScript的对象映射技术,该技术可以将JavaScript对象映射为一个数组。该方法主要用于将JavaScript对象转换为适合存储在数据库中的一维或二维数组,以便存储和检索数据。
## toArray方法的主要原理
toArray方法的主要原理是将JavaScript对象的属性转换为一个数组。该方法首先检查对象的每个属性,并将其值添加到一个新的数组中,即构建了一个一维数组。然后,它递归地处理每一个属性,检查它是否是一个对象,如果是,则继续调用toArray方法,直到所有属性都被遍历到。每次遍历完成,将该子对象的属性添加到主数组中,以形成一个多维数组,最终实现把JavaScript对象映射为一个数组的目的。
## toArray方法的主要用途
toArray方法的主要目的是将JavaScript对象映射为一个数组,以便存储和检索数据,其主要应用有:
(1)可以用来将JavaScript对象转换为存储在数据库中的一维或多维数据,以便使用数据库技术检索和索引数据。
(2)可以用来将复杂的JavaScript对象转换为简单的对象,以便更加容易组织和管理数据。
(3)可以用来将复杂的JavaScript对象转换为简单的字符串,以便传输数据到另一台服务器或设备。
(4)可以用来将JavaScript对象转换为具有易于阅读、操作和编辑的格式,以便用于视图和网页的渲染。
(5)可以用来将JavaScript对象转换为JSON格式,以便对对象中的数据进行更加有效和可靠的处理。
js 二维数组 ## toArray方法的注意事项
toArray方法的应用虽广,但也存在一些需要注意的地方,主要有以下几点:
(1)使用toArray方法转换JavaScript对象时,要将复杂的对象分解为多个简单的对象,以便更好地转换和存储数据。
(2)toArray方法不能对所有对象都起作用,某些类型的对象比如函数或Object对象无法转换成数组,因此需要特别注意。
(3)在使用toArray方法转换JavaScript对象时,应根据不同的使用场景,选择适当的转换策略,以确保转换的效率和可控性。
(4)如果对象属性中包含多个重复属性,如同名属性,则使用toArray方法时,需要特别注意,要确保数组中不出现重复的属性值。
(5)如果对象中包含函数,则在使用toArray方法时,应先将函数转换为字符串,以便以字符串形式存储在数组中。
##论
toArray方法是一种基于JavaScript的对象映射技术,它可以将JavaScript对象映射为一个
数组,以便存储和检索数据。该方法的主要用途是将JavaScript对象转换为存储在数据库中的一维或多维数据,并将复杂的JavaScript对象转换为简单的字符串,以便传输数据。但是,在使用toArray方法转换JavaScript对象时,仍需注意一些注意事项,以确保转换的效率和可控性。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论